How do you handle the removal of hard-to-get-out burrs and field debris that my dog picks up from exploring the trails around the Republican River?

Removing burrs and sticky weeds is a specialty of ours. We never simply cut them out unless absolutely necessary. Instead, we use a combination of detangling sprays, conditioners, and careful hand-separation to work through the matted fur and debris safely and with minimal discomfort to your pet. This is a common request, so we build extra time into appointments when this service is needed.

First, it's important to know that dedicated dog spas are often found in larger cities. Here in Blue Hill, you'll typically find these services offered by local groomers, some mobile groomers who come to you, or even as an add-on at veterinary clinics. The 'near me' for us means supporting our local small businesses, which is a wonderful way to care for our pets and our community.

So, what about prices? In our area, you can expect a basic spa-style bath and brush package for a medium-sized dog to start around $45-$65. This usually includes a premium shampoo, conditioning treatment, thorough brushing, nail trim, ear cleaning, and a bandana. For larger breeds or dogs with thick coats like Huskies or Golden Retrievers, prices may range from $65 to $85. Add-ons like de-shedding treatments, teeth brushing, or specialty paw balms (perfect for our fluctuating Nebraska weather!) might add $10-$20 to the total. Always ask for a detailed price list when you call.

Here’s some practical advice for Blue Hill pet owners. Before booking, have a chat with the groomer. Explain your dog's lifestyle—do they swim in the Little Blue River? Roll in who-knows-what on the farm? This helps them recommend the right services. Consider scheduling spa sessions seasonally; a good de-shedding in spring is invaluable, and a moisturizing treatment in winter protects against dry, cracked paws.

To make the most of your budget, look for groomers who offer loyalty discounts or package deals. Some may provide a discount for scheduling your next appointment before you leave. And remember, regular brushing at home between spa visits can extend the time needed between professional grooms, saving you money in the long run.
